What are Cloud Providers?

Cloud providers are companies that offer computing services over the internet, allowing businesses to access and utilize resources without the need for on-premises hardware. These services include infrastructure (IaaS), platforms (PaaS), and software (SaaS), which can be scaled up or down based on demand. The primary advantage of using a cloud provider is the ability to focus on core business operations while leveraging the provider’s resources, expertise, and infrastructure.

Importance of Cloud Providers

Cloud providers are essential for several reasons:

  1. Scalability: Cloud providers offer the ability to scale resources up or down based on business needs. This flexibility ensures that organizations can respond to changing demands without significant capital investment.
  2. Cost Efficiency: By using cloud services, businesses can reduce the costs associated with maintaining and upgrading physical infrastructure. Cloud providers offer a pay-as-you-go model, allowing organizations to pay only for the resources they use.
  3. Accessibility: Cloud services can be accessed from anywhere with an internet connection, supporting remote work and collaboration. This accessibility enhances productivity and allows employees to work efficiently from any location.
  4. Security: Leading cloud providers invest heavily in security measures to protect data and ensure compliance with regulations. These measures include encryption, multi-factor authentication, and regular security audits.
  5. Innovation: Cloud providers offer access to cutting-edge technologies, such as art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and big data analytics. This enables businesses to innovate and stay competitive in their industries.

Key Considerations for Choosing a Cloud Provider

When selecting a cloud provider, it is essential to consider several factors to ensure that the chosen provider meets your business needs. Here are some key considerations:

  1. Service Offerings: Evaluate the range of services offered by the cloud provider. Ensure that they provide the specific services you need, such as IaaS, PaaS, or SaaS. Additionally, consider the provider’s capabilities in areas such as AI, ML, and data analytics.
  2. Reliability and Performance: Assess the provider’s reliability and performance metrics, such as uptime guarantees and latency. Look for a provider with a strong track record of high availability and low downtime.
  3. Security and Compliance: Ensure that the cloud provider offers robust security measures and complies with relevant regulations and standards, such as GDPR, HIPAA, and SOC 2. Consider the provider’s data encryption practices, access controls, and security certifications.
  4. Scalability and Flexibility: Choose a provider that can scale resources to meet your business needs. Evaluate their scalability options, such as auto-scaling and load balancing, and ensure that they offer flexible pricing models.
  5. Support and Customer Service: Evaluate the provider’s customer support offerings, including availability, response times, and support channels. Look for providers that offer 24/7 support and dedicated account managers.
  6. Cost and Pricing: Compare the pricing models of different cloud providers and consider the total cost of ownership. Look for transparent pricing structures and consider any additional costs, such as data transfer fees and support charges.
  7. Ecosystem and Integrations: Consider the provider’s ecosystem and the availability of integrations with other tools and services you use. A robust ecosystem can enhance the functionality and interoperability of your cloud environment.

Top Cloud Providers

Several leading cloud providers dominate the market, each offering a range of services and features. Here are some of the top cloud providers:

  1. Amazon Web Services (AWS): AWS is one of the most comprehensive and widely adopted cloud platforms, offering a broad range of services, including computing, storage, databases, AI, and ML. AWS is known for its scalability, reliability, and extensive global infrastructure.
  2. Microsoft Azure: Azure is a leading cloud platform that provides a wide array of services, including computing, storage, databases, AI, and ML. Azure integrates seamlessly with Microsoft’s ecosystem, making it an ideal choice for businesses using Microsoft products.
  3. Google Cloud Platform (GCP): GCP offers a range of cloud services, including computing, storage, databases, AI, and ML. GCP is known for its advanced data analytics and machine learning capabilities, making it a preferred choice for data-driven businesses.
  4. IBM Cloud: IBM Cloud offers a range of cloud services, including IaaS, PaaS, and SaaS. IBM Cloud is known for its strong focus on AI and ML, as well as its enterprise-grade security and compliance features.
  5. Oracle Cloud: Oracle Cloud offers a range of cloud services, including computing, storage, databases, and enterprise applications. Oracle Cloud is known for its strong focus on database services and enterprise solutions.

Future Trends in Cloud Providers

As cloud computing continues to evolve, staying ahead of trends is essential for maintaining an effective cloud strategy. Here are some key trends to watch for in the future:

  1. Hybrid and Multi-Cloud Strategies: Businesses are increasingly adopting hybrid and multi-cloud strategies to leverage the benefits of multiple cloud providers and on-premises infrastructure. This approach offers greater flexibility, redundancy, and risk mitigation.
  2. Edge Computing: Edge computing involves processing data closer to the source, reducing latency and improving performance. Cloud providers are expanding their edge computing capabilities to support applications that require real-time processing, such as IoT and autonomous vehicles.
  3. AI and Machine Learning Integration: Cloud providers are integrating AI and machine learning capabilities into their platforms, enabling businesses to harness the power of these technologies. AI and ML can enhance data analytics, automate processes, and improve decision-making.
  4. Serverless Computing: Serverless computing allows developers to build and deploy applications without managing the underlying infrastructure. This approach reduces complexity and improves scalability, enabling faster development and deployment.
  5. Enhanced Security: As cyber threats continue to evolve, cloud providers are investing in advanced security measures, such as zero-trust architecture, AI-driven threat detection, and quantum-safe encryption. Enhanced security features help protect data and ensure compliance.
  6. Sustainability Initiatives: Cloud providers are increasingly focusing on sustainability initiatives to reduce their environmental impact. This includes using renewable energy, improving energy efficiency, and supporting carbon offset programs.
